Output 43ffa75063fc43ba13c84833c1b56c9f7df07a24f98994e806b23a48ba122934:0

value
30754107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6620abc142e1f034caac0a03b1ddec343c5e0e92 OP_EQUAL
address
MHDAJ1enG5UkWz1UBUPjMESaKUhXoU48q8
transaction
43ffa75063fc43ba13c84833c1b56c9f7df07a24f98994e806b23a48ba122934
spent
true